jQuery是一種廣泛應用于前端開發的JavaScript庫,它簡化了HTML文檔遍歷、事件處理、動畫效果等操作。本文將介紹一些jQuery高級應用技巧,幫助讀者更好地掌握jQuery。
1. 使用鏈式調用
jQuery的鏈式調用是一種非常方便的操作方式,可以讓代碼更加簡潔易讀。例如:
```javascriptgsoveClass('active');
這行代碼就是先選中class為box的元素,添加active類,然后選中兄弟元素并移除active類。
2. 使用事件代理
事件代理是指將事件處理程序綁定到父元素上,而不是直接綁定到子元素上。這種方式可以減少事件處理程序的數量,提高性能。例如:
```javascriptction(){sole.log($(this).text());
這行代碼就是在ul元素上綁定click事件,當子元素li被點擊時,事件會冒泡到ul元素上,觸發事件處理程序。
3. 使用動畫效果
jQuery提供了豐富的動畫效果,可以讓頁面更加生動有趣。例如:
```javascriptimate({
width: '+=50px',
height: '+=50px'
}, 1000);
這行代碼就是選中class為box的元素,讓它的寬度和高度分別增加50px,動畫時間為1秒。
4. 使用插件
jQuery插件可以擴展jQuery的功能,讓開發更加便捷。例如:
```javascriptyPluginction(){
// 插件代碼
yPluginyPlugin()來使用。
掌握這些jQuery高級應用技巧可以讓開發更加高效、簡潔、靈活。同時,jQuery作為一種廣泛應用的前端開發庫,也需要不斷學習和掌握。